A leading power systems consultancy in Manchester is seeking an experienced Power Systems Engineer to conduct dynamic analysis and ensure UK Grid Code compliance.
The ideal candidate will have at least 2 years' experience, proficiency in DIgSILENT PowerFactory and PSCAD, and strong communication skills.
This role is crucial for delivering high-quality consulting services and managing key client relationships.
Join a company that values teamwork and innovation while making a significant impact in the electrical power field.
